Abstract

Enterprise systems and architectures are a field of significant research, especially in regard to service-oriented architectures and web services. Web services propose great benefits and are often suggested as the new paradigm for building distributed applications and systems, but they are becoming more and more complex and consequently less understandable for humans. The web development community on the other side widely backs the resource-oriented paradigm of REpresentational State Transfer (REST). While REST has been one of the success factors of the World Wide Web, it has not been taken into deeper consideration for enterprise architectures yet. This paper presents a new system architecture which is based on the primitives of REST and a layered architectural concept, which offers a unified interface, integrates type definitions of available resources, allows all CRUD-operations on secured disparate sources and could be and has been used for enterprise system integration purposes.

Share

COinS